WvW is probably the main reason a lot of players want a way to turn off their pet. They have limited value in real WvW/GvG battles because of how easy they’re killed from splash damage. Why should the ranger have their attack coefficients handicapped for a mechanic that doesn’t work? And this is completely ignoring the simple fact that pets don’t work as they should regardless of where they are.
They need to:
Make all pets do the same DPS.
Make pet DPS low enough to warrant Rangers having proper skill coefficients.
Make F2 abilities break attack chains and begin their animation immediately.
Make all F2 abilities have a .5 second cast before the ability goes off and they can continue the remainder of their animation later.
Make F1 attack and recall the pet.
Make F3 activate secondary pet skills with the same rules as F2 but default them to auto so a player has to turn auto off.
If the pet didn’t handicap our damage and F2s were actually reliable I wouldn’t care that my pet died in .5 seconds in WvW.

One problem with pet survivability come for a lack of anti CC mechanics such as stability or passive condition removal. Even if you spec the Ranger to have Entropic bond, Signet of the Wild(for pet Stability), Signet of Stone, Guard(with Nature’s Voice), and Rampage as One, that pet is still going to die a meaningless death from all of the splash damage and CC when running in and out of zergs. You have to pop Guard—→ than Signet of the Wild (or Rampage as One) —→ than Signet of Stone-—→ so our pets can live through the first clash of a zerg battle. And the funny thing is: you have to spec 30 points into Signets of the Beastmaster to get the Signets actives to affect the Ranger too and in order to have passive pet condition removal; the Ranger needs to go 30 points into Wilderness Survival; furthermore, if you want the regen and swiftness from Guard, you have to go 30 points into Nature Magic.
Even with all of this effort to keep a pet alive, the pet will not cast is F2 properly because its responsiveness is all based on luck or you tab targeted a player or its minion that is 1200 range away from you in the complete different direction you are running towards.
